Welcome to the Fernwick firmware team. All device-firmware updates ship through the Driftline channel service, which gates rollouts by hardware revision and region cohort. As a reviewer, you should verify that any change to the channel manifest bumps the schema version and includes a rollback stanza — the Driftline validator will reject merges without one. You can run the validator locally against the staging channel endpoint before approving. The staging service authenticates requests with the internal key shown below.

gateway credential: kto3_qfe

### ORION-2291: Intermittent connection failures on profile shards

Since we split the user-profile store across four shards, the router occasionally drops connections when shard 3 rebalances. Pretty sure the pool isn't refreshing its topology cache after a rebalance event — restarting the router fixes it every time, which is a clue, not a fix. If you need to poke at shard 3 directly while debugging, connect with the string below.

primary connection of yagep-kahip = redis://giliel_svc:zYiKsLL2PLpfPL@db-348f.xolmarsys.corp:5432/fenwyn

Deploy step 4: Reminder job for the Fernwell Clinic scheduler. Confirm the cron container builds from the reminder-worker image, not the legacy notifier. Check that timezone handling uses clinic-local time; reviewers flagged UTC drift last cycle. Verify retry backoff caps at three attempts and that opted-out patients are excluded at query time, not send time. Migrations must run before the worker starts or the outbox table will be missing. Finally, in the worker's .env, add this line so the job can sign outgoing requests:

env line for fafof-fahag: LEDGER_TOKEN5=f8790